About the Hotel
Renaissancehotel Raffelsberger Hof B&B is a historic property dating back to 1574, originally serving as a shipmaster's house. Nestled in the UNESCO World Heritage Site of Wachau, it blends cultural richness with serenity. This hotel features an atmosphere of well-preserved antiquity combined with modern amenities for a unique guest experience. It serves as an ideal base for exploring the Wachau Valley, known for its picturesque landscapes, flora, and local vineyards.
Location
Renaissancehotel Raffelsberger Hof B&B is strategically situated just 68.5 miles from Vienna International Airport, making it easily accessible. The hotel is located in Weissenkirchen, a quaint village surrounded by numerous renaissance buildings and scenic views, enhancing the area's charm. Guests can explore the cultural landscape of Wachau on foot or by renting bicycles for a more adventurous experience.

Eat & Drink
Guests can start their day with a generous breakfast buffet in the Baroque breakfast room, showcasing a range of regional products and homemade treats. The Renaissance vaulted lounge, open 24 hours, presents an inviting atmosphere for enjoying fine wines in a historic setting. Local, traditional Austrian taverns, known as Heurigen, are also nearby, where visitors can sample homegrown wines and regional specialties.
